SX Inclusive Activities recognises London 2012 Paralympic values such as equality through delivering a programme of activities for disabled young people and adults within Essex over the next two years.
This project will involve a number of taster events, competitive events and gifted and talented events across the county in both schools and the community.
Project partners include School Sports Partnerships, Competition Managers, Local Authorities, National Governing Bodies of Sport, Community Sports Trust and the Essex County Council 2012 Legacy team.
The project engages with disabled young people and adults, providing participation opportunities, whatever their ability, providing opportunities to continue in their chosen sport by linking to National Governing Bodies’, sports clubs, competitions and festivals.
A range of festivals will be on offer that could lead to continued participation, and in the case of the Athletics festival will lead to higher competitive opportunities with the Regional Athletics competition. There are also a range of clubs (cricket and football for example) that offer disability sessions, coaching and access to competition. There are also new clubs forming for example a Boccia club in Chelmsford that will offer a new opportunity to try a sport that is not there at present.
Events will include Special Schools Competitive event and non competitive events, Playground to Podium , BOCCIA , JUDO, DISABILITY MULTI SPORTS CLUB, Table Cricket at Essex County Cricket Ground, Zone Hockey, Aqua Playground to Podium, Panathlon, Inclusive Fencing Festivals, Kwik Cricket, Special Schools Aqua Splash, Essex Powerchair Football sessions, The Essex County Football Association’s Soccability League, ATHLETICS, DISABILITY SPORTS DAY, table tennis, trampolining, ice skating, swimming.
